Communication Strategies for the Busy Farmer
Time is a scarce resource when you’re balancing planting, harvesting, and family duties. Effective communication helps you make the most of brief windows of free time.
- Set a daily check‑in – Even a five‑minute message in the morning can keep the connection alive.
- Use voice notes – A quick “Good morning from the barn!” feels personal and saves typing time.
- Share farm updates – A photo of a fresh crop or a short video of a sunrise over the hills invites conversation naturally.

Safety First: Meeting in Person
Even in a close‑knit community, taking precautions is wise. Here are simple steps to keep your first meeting safe and enjoyable:
- Choose a public spot – A coffee shop in Charleston or a farmer’s market in Morgantown works well.
- Tell a friend – Let a family member know where you’re going and who you’re meeting.
- Plan a short date – A 1–2 hour meetup lets you gauge chemistry without committing a whole day.

Advanced Tips for Long‑Term Compatibility
Finding a match is only the first step. Keeping the relationship strong while managing farm responsibilities requires intentional effort.
- Schedule regular “farm‑free” time – Set aside a weekend each month for a date night away from the fields.
- Create shared goals – Whether it’s expanding the barn, starting a beekeeping hobby, or planning a future home renovation, working toward a common project strengthens bonds.
- Communicate about workload – Be open about busy seasons (planting, harvest) so your partner knows when you might be less available.
